While very true, it is hard to ignore the similarities between the FF and the Doom Patrol. Don't get me wrong, I'm not saying they're too similar to each other now, but back in the day, they largely corresponded with one another.
Robotman: a "man turned monster" who views himself as less than human. Corresponds to the Thing.
Negative Man: a guy who flies around and can generate explosions sort of like Johnny Storm can (albeit in a much different way than Johnny can).
Elasti-Girl: a beautiful woman who marries one of the other members of the team and has a family with him. Corresponds to Sue Storm (and I guess you can sort of say Steve Dayton corresponds to Reed Richards).
I guess the main differences were that (a) the FF were loved by the public, and the Doom Patrol were hated and (b) that Mento and Elast-Girl's marriage didn't last, while Reed and Sue's did.
